Rabbi: Handshake column shows Cohen's ignorant, but not an antisemite
The Forward
In last Sunday's "The Ethicist" column, a woman wrote that she was offended when her real-estate agent refused to shake hands, saying that as an Orthodox Jew he didn't touch women. Should I tear up the contract? she asked. Randy Cohen's response -- "I believe you should tear up your contract" -- brought in hundreds of angry e-mails, reports Alana Newhouse. One rabbi says of the column: "I thought it showed a stunning lack of appreciation and responsibility for Orthodoxy Jewry." Another says of Cohen: "He's ignorant, but not hateful. I don't think he's an antisemite."
